    Type of training during EC Stack? (reps!)

    Hey guys, I'm re-evaluating a lot of my training / diet. I'm going to start calorie and carb cycling soon, along with an EC stack.

    Could I get some advice on what type of training to do?

    I read an article on carb-cycling which poo-poo'd too much cardio (exceeding 1 - 2 times a day). Instead it suggested doing a 5 day split of weight training with one or two days cardio.

    Thing is, I'm used to doing 45 minutes HIIT 5 days a week with 3 days of weight training.

    Should I hit the weights (5 day split with 2 days of cardio)... or continue my 3 day split with 5 days of 45 minutes of HIIT?

    Which would you recommend during EC cycling?

    Well I started carb cycling and EC stack last week.
    Doing 3 day split weight training now Monday, Wednesday, Friday. I do cardio 5 days a week. 20mins after weight training and 40 mins on Tuesday and Thursday. All cardio is Low intensity. First week lost about 1.5 pounds and .5% body fat the scale said not sure how accurate that is. Tried doing HIIT today and my heart about exploded, felt lightheaded, and wanted to pass out had to sit down for about 30 mins to recover. Just my 2 cents.

    For the low intensity cardio, I try to stay between 60-75% heart rate. 75% on weight training days since I have PWO carbs, but 60% on non-training days since those are my NO carb days.
